Lionel Messi spoke with TyC Sports about his two sons, 5-year-old Thiago and 2-year-old Mateo. First, he discussed how Thiago isn’t as football-mad as Luis Suárez’s son, Benja:
“Thiago’s friend, Luis’s son, Benja. They have the same age and he’s football crazy. He loves to play football, he watches football, he knows all the players. And Thiago no, he likes cars, he likes motorcycles, he plays other things. He likes football, but just a bit. He plays a bit, and he gets tired.”
When asked about little Mateo though, Messi joked:
“Mateo... terrible. Mateo is a character. They’re very different. Thiago is a phenomenon, really good. And the other, the exact opposite: a son of a bitch. Mateo is terrible. It’s really good seeing how different they are. Mateo does play a bit of football, right-footed. He’s more coordinated. He hits it well. But, he’s small.”
